* Check this out: Clinical study says support is essential
The Journal of the American Medical Association (JAMA) published a large weight-loss maintenance study of 1,032 overweight and obese adults in 2008. The study found that brief personal counseling and Web-based intervention strategies offer the best hope in keeping weight off over three years.
"The big discovery of this study is that losing weight and keeping it off is possible if you have ongoing, long-term support," said study second author Victor J. Stevens, Ph.D., a senior researcher at Kaiser Permanente's Center for Health Research.
"Everyone in this country—men, women, and children of every racial group—is getting heavier because our society promotes eating too much and not getting enough exercise,” Dr. Stevens says. “We all need a personal health coach."
